Learn About Judaism

Judaism is a global faith community with a rich history and a strong commitment to promoting social justice, promoting interfaith dialogue, and providing support to vulnerable communities around the world. According to the Pew Research Center, Judaism is the world's 11th-largest religion, with over 14 million adherents worldwide. There has been a growing recognition of the importance of promoting social justice and addressing issues such as poverty, inequality, and discrimination within Jewish communities. Many Jewish organizations and institutions have a strong commitment to promoting human rights, providing access to education and healthcare services, and supporting marginalized communities. Additionally, there has been a renewed emphasis on promoting interfaith dialogue and cooperation, with many Jewish leaders and institutions working to build bridges between different religious communities and promote mutual understanding and respect. These positive trends have contributed to improvements in the lives of many individuals around the world, with some countries reporting reductions in poverty and increased access to essential services for vulnerable communities. Additionally, there has been a growing recognition of the importance of promoting peace and reconciliation, and working to address issues such as conflict and violence in order to build a more just and peaceful world.
